This patch series introduces asynchronous writeback to the zram module.
By moving to an asynchronous model, we can perform writeback operations
more efficiently.
The series is structured as follows:
The first patch is a preparatory refactoring that moves all
writeback-related code into its own files (zram_wb.[ch]) without any
functional changes.
The second patch introduces the core infrastructure for asynchronicity,
including a dedicated kthread, a request queue, and helper functions to
manage writeback requests.
The final patch enables asynchronous writeback by switching from
submit_bio_wait() to the non-blocking submit_bio(). This patch also
includes performance benchmarks demonstrating a 27% improvement in
idle writeback speed on an Android platform.
